Natural Habitat Explained\u003c\/h2\u003e\u003cp\u003eThe natural \u003cstrong\u003ethree-spot gourami habitat\u003c\/strong\u003e is spread across Southeast Asia, especially Thailand, Malaysia, and Indonesia. In the wild, these fish inhabit slow-moving waters such as floodplain pools, ditches, marshes, canals, and gently flowing streams with dense vegetation. These waters are often warm, slightly stained, and full of submerged roots, floating plants, and leaf litter. That background explains why a calm aquarium with cover near the surface suits them so well.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eUnlike species adapted to fast current, Three-Spot Gourami evolved in places where still water and plant cover offer safety and feeding opportunities. They browse on insect larvae, tiny crustaceans, plant matter, and organic debris. Like other gouramis, they are bubble nest builders. The male constructs a floating nest from bubbles and plant fragments, then courts the female beneath it.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003ch3\u003eBreeding Setup\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cp\u003eUse a separate breeding tank of around 60-90 litres with shallow to moderate water depth, gentle filtration, floating plants, and a temperature near 27-28°C. Condition the pair with frozen and live foods. A calm environment is essential because surface disturbance can damage the nest. During courtship, the male intensifies in colour, flares fins, and leads the female toward the nest. Spawning happens in embraces beneath the nest, with eggs rising upward for the male to collect and place into the bubbles.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003ch3\u003eEgg Care \u0026amp; Hatching\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cp\u003eAfter spawning, remove the female if the male becomes aggressive. He guards the nest and tends the eggs. Hatching usually occurs in about 24-36 hours depending on temperature. Once fry are free-swimming, the male should also be removed. They are observant fish that learn feeding routines quickly and often watch activity outside the glass. Most spend their time in the upper half of the tank, cruising slowly, investigating plants with their feeler-like pelvic fins, and surfacing for air.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eThey are not schooling fish. Adults are best described as loosely social but territorial, especially males. This explains why \u003cstrong\u003ethree-spot gourami with other fish\u003c\/strong\u003e can work well while same-species groupings sometimes fail in cramped conditions. In a calm aquarium they are confident and visible; in an overstocked or aggressive setup they become defensive or withdrawn.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eNatural behaviour is easiest to see in a spacious, planted aquarium with floating cover. Bubble nest building, fin flaring, and gentle courtship displays are all normal.
